URGENT AMBER Alert: 12-year-old Texas girl abducted, in grave danger

Authorities in Texas are searching for a 12-year-old girl who they believe was abducted on Tuesday night.

CBS Austin reports that Amisty Monrreal was last seen at a location on Barrett Place in San Antonio at about 10 p.m. Tuesday. She reportedly has a health condition that requires medical care, and police believe she is in immediate danger. Investigators have classified her disappearance as an abduction, but authorities have not released any information about a suspect or how they might be traveling.

Amisty is described as 5 feet tall and weighing 90 pounds. She has brown hair with highlights and was last seen wearing jeans, a black shirt with the number 45 on the front, and black-grey Jordan shoes.

Anyone with information is urged to call the San Antonio Police Department’s Missing Persons Unit at (210) 207-7660.
